江蘇省無錫汽車工程中等專業學校 潘 巍
云計算技術在圖書館應用中的分析
江蘇省無錫汽車工程中等專業學校潘巍
隨著云計算技術不斷開發與應用,強大的功能逐漸被廣泛的公共領域所應用。而公共圖書館承載著傳播知識的重擔,必須要引入先進的管理水平和服務手段,因而需要引入先進的管理技術,采用信息化技術方法促進圖書館事業的發展是必然趨勢。本文闡述了云計算技術的概念及優勢,在此基礎上探討圖書館對云計算技術的應用。
云計算技術;圖書館;應用
隨著網絡普及及用戶應用計算機的水平不斷提高,圖書館必然要利用網絡給用戶提供便捷的服務,有效提升圖書館的社會地位。但是在應用過程中遇到了許多困境與挑戰,比如受到黑客攻擊,服務器的硬件配置無法滿足用戶所需等;這些問題都將給圖書館帶來一定的損失。就需要利用一些新方法解決存在的問題,從而確保圖書館的發展。在這種形勢下,分析圖書館應用云計算技術具有現實意義。
(1)云計算技術概念;云計算屬于一種并行處理、分布式處理與網格設計的新模式,極對計算機科學概念的一種商業實現。就是將分布在計算機產品上的大量數據與資源整合到一起,二者協同工作。相關的各類計算分布到大量的計算機上,但是并非遠程服務器或者本地計算機中,讓相關數據中心運行和互聯網相似;云計算屬于一種新興共享基礎架構的模式,這種模式將系統池結合在一起提供各類服務。用戶就能夠便利的把資源切換到應用中,依據所需對計算機與存儲體系進行訪問。
(2)云計算技術的優勢;云計算技術屬于一種比較先進的技術,自然有其自己獨特的優勢,主要體現在如下幾個方面:
其一,云計算能夠減少服務器的出錯率;對于圖書館管理而言,重點就是數據處理,一旦數據處理中心出現問題,就可能造成圖書館癱瘓,嚴重影響圖書館的使用價值。但是通過云計算技術就能夠解決存在的問題,因在計算過程中許多服務器參與進來,如果某一些服務器出現了狀況,就會影響云計算的運用。隨著計算機技術與網絡技術的發展,應用云計算技術明顯提升了圖書館的管理效率,降低了失誤率,有效保存了資源數據。而且引用云計算還提高了刪除、查找、增加記錄等各功能的簡便性。因此就能夠降低服務器的出錯率。
其二,云計算的成本不高,運算能力極強;因圖書館的普通服務器受到各種限制。一旦用戶數量增大時,服務器就會發生超過自身所限,導致服務器癱瘓。而運行速度就是客戶端、瀏覽器端的訪問速度,一旦發生癱瘓就會發生延遲現象。因此就必須要限制圖書館服務器最大相應數量。假如使用量過大,一些訪問用戶就會出現無相應狀況。假如圖書館要滿足各個用戶所需,就要出資購買更多、配置更高的服務器。但是應用云計算技術,僅僅支付極少費用,就能夠滿足圖書館服務所需,有效降低了圖書館的成本,獲得較高效益。
其三,實現了資源最大化共享;應用云計算技術就能夠給單個圖書館提供廉價、高效的服務,就在圖書館間形成圖書共享平臺,讓各個圖書館成為一個整體,從而實現了信息交換、分享,而且經過大量系統的連接,就實現了基礎設施的共享。給借閱者提供便利同時還實現了最大化服務,實現了最小化資金投入,而且通過云計算技術模式,借閱者就能夠隨意瀏覽所需的圖書。
筆者結合所學知識,提出了一體圖書館應用云計算技術的架構體系,如圖1所示:

圖1 圖書館應用云計算技術的架構體系
從上圖所示結構來看,就能夠看出云計算環境下圖書館的應用系統主要劃分成為了三個層次,從底層至高層依次是基礎設施層,平臺服務層與LAS應用服務層。從圖中來看,整個圖書館的用戶群體均是通過一對一借口使用各個服務項目,右側安全管理滲透至整個云計算自動化系統中,就要圖書館及軟件提供商與云計算服務提供商等各個方面協商,形成一個多方面可以接受的規則,通過安全管理就把這個規則監管作為默認的執行系統。
(1)基礎設施層;該層在整個系統中處于最底層,就可把這個層次作為一個資源池,包含了存儲能力、處理能力等等,云計算就把網絡中各種計算資源整合成一體,形成一個虛擬的超級電腦,同時時刻監管計算機的CPU、路由器、內存以及防火墻等各種設備的使用與運行狀態,平衡了各個設施的負載情況。云服務圖書館就要和LAS軟件所提供商合作軟件的實施方式與部署,當然軟件提供商能夠選擇與控制存儲空間與操作系統等內容,依據圖書館要求選擇私有云、公有云與混合云的使用方式,并要求云服務提供可伸縮的、動態的資源。在該層中,無論是軟件提供商還是圖書館,并不會關系數據存儲到那個服務器中,因云服務提供商就要調度需求與備份轉移數據等各種技術問題,促進了圖書館的基礎設施與數據安全的管理與維護。
(2)平臺服務層;使用該層次者即為LAS軟件提供商,當供應商把開發環境部署進基礎設施層之后,就能夠通過該資源池中計算力開發系統,而軟件提供商根本不用控制與管理操作系統、網絡傳輸及服務器等,但可以控制開發環境下的配置。而提供軟件者研發系統時,就必須要遵循云計算理念,采用面向服務結構SOA開發出各種圖書館的自動化軟件,進一步細化了業務流程中的各項功能,形成單獨模塊,這種模塊下無論是大型圖書館還是中小型圖書館都能夠適用。
(3)LAS應用服務層;在該層次中圖書館就要真正參與圖書館系統的建設中,但是就需要LAS軟件提供商通過租賃方式按照一對一接口把圖書館系統服務模式連接到LAS應用服務層中,負責管理業務的人員就要依據圖書館實情建立個性化的系統,因此在該過程中圖書館就要和軟件提供者商談采用哪種云服務類型,也就是私有云、公有云以及混合云按照哪種模式安排。整個系統架構要具有靈活性,必須要打破傳統的集成化環境下圖書館作為使用云計算一方,就能夠提出更多服務要求,特別是計量與收費環節上,和過去一次性購買方式不同,云環境下支出費用就可以控制到一定范圍,而隨著服務租賃的變化而變化,有其是更加環保更加節約。
(4)用戶終端;在這個層面上可以劃分成兩類,即為讀者用戶和工作人員,用戶經過終端瀏覽器使用軟件,也就客戶端,從用
戶角度來看通過云就能夠享受到一些了圖書館系統與過去使用并沒有太多區別,除了網絡限制一些訪問,僅僅修改界面表示即可。
(5)安全管理,此處的安全管理包含了用戶分身認證、訪問授權、系統安全審計及綜合防護等,因此安全是整個體系每個環節都要高度重視的,云計算僅僅提供一個互聯網基礎,按照所需收費,這就決定了每一個層次中數據交換與執行任務時,都必須需要第三那方審計與監測,確保整個系統具有一個穩定的運行狀態。圖書館就要與每一個層次進行充分溝通,測試之后就要考慮到系統的費用、性能、安全以及擴展性等各方面的問題,然后制定出各個方面都能夠認同的方案,當然各方面都必須要清楚所承擔的責任,同時還要嚴格遵循安全管理的契約,圖書館與提供軟件者進行商議時,就應該針對云服務所需提出要求,圖書館應該把整個系統項目的建設托管給某個軟件開發商,軟件開發商就直接和提供云服務的供應商進行交涉,同時還可以進行三方交流。
出現了云計算技術,為互聯網環境下發揮圖書館信息資源作用帶來了巨大的機遇。當然云計算技術應用還在開發研究階段,因此就需要結合圖書館實際情況采取合理的應用。隨著云計算技術日趨成熟,圖書館應用云計算技術是發展的必然趨勢。
[1]李開復.云計算[J].中國教育網絡,2012(6):34.
[2]樂天.存儲領域的新角色:云計算[J].計算機世界,2013.
[3]樂天.存儲領域的新角色:云計算[J].計算機世界,2013(11).
[4]陳康,鄭緯民.云計算:構建基于互聯網的應用[J].計算機世界,2011.
[5]謝世清.論云計算及其在金融領域中的應用[J].金融與經濟,2O10(11).